Commercial Slab Installation in West Des Moines, IA
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ete foundations for a variety of property projects, including retail spaces, warehouses, garages, and other large-scale structures. This process ensures a stable, level surface that supports the weight and use of commercial buildings, providing a durable base for construction. Property owners typically seek this service to establish a solid foundation for new developments or to replace existing slabs that have become cracked or uneven, helping to maintain safety and functionality on the property.
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ners often want to understand the scope of the project, including site preparation requirements, the type of concrete used, and any necessary permits or inspections. It’s also helpful to consider factors like drainage, load-bearing needs, and future expansion plans. Clear communication about these aspects can ensure the project aligns with the property’s needs and that the installation process proceeds smoothly.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are commonly used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and outdoor workspaces on commercial properties.
What is the typical process for installing a commercial slab? The process generally involves site preparation, form setting, reinforcement placement, concrete pouring, and finishing to ensure durability and levelness.
What factors influence the durability of a commercial slab? Proper soil preparation, quality of materials, reinforcement placement, and finishing techniques all contribute to the slab’s longevity and performance.
Are there specific considerations for residential versus commercial slab installation? Yes, commercial slabs often require thicker concrete, reinforced reinforcement, and specific design features to support heavier loads and usage.
